Increasingly Crowded Market for Second-Line Therapies Improving Treatment Options for Moderate-to-Severe Rheumatoid Arthritis Patients

Rheumatoid Arthritis (RA) is a chronic, progressive and currently incurable autoimmune disease that primarily affects joints. It is characterized by synovial inflammation and gradual bone erosion over many years, and disease progression results in stiffness and pain, especially in the hands and feet, which hinders patient mobility. Without treatment, the disease leads to joint destruction and disability. Prior to 1998, treatment options were limited to small-molecule disease-modifying therapies, such as Methotrexate (MTX), sulfasalazine and anti-malarials. However, while MTX is efficacious in controlling RA symptoms in a large percentage of patients, approximately 33% are unresponsive to these first-line drugs. The approval of revolutionary biological therapies, including Enbrel, Remicade and Humira, for the treatment of RA patients that are refractory to MTX has triggered unparalleled growth in the market.


Globally, there are at least 12 biological therapies, including monoclonal antibodies (mAb), biosimilars and therapeutic proteins, competing as second-line therapies for this sub-population. Over the past 16 years, the therapeutic market for RA has become extremely competitive as a result of the high number of new drug approvals. Competition for Tumor Necrosis Factor Alpha (TNF-a) inhibitors is particularly fierce, and now dominates the treatment market for RA patients who are refractory to first-line Disease Modifying Anti-Rheumatic Drugs (DMARD). In 2013, three TNF-a targeting mAbs, Humira (adalimumab), Remicade (infliximab) and Enbrel (etanercept), were ranked among the top-10 best-selling drugs in the world, with global revenues of $11.1 billion, $9.9 billion and $8.9 billion respectively, reflecting their groundbreaking clinical and commercial success. Despite this, 30% of RA patients fail to achieve clinical responses when treated with TNF-a inhibitors (Rubbert-Roth and Finckh, 2009). However, patients who are unresponsive to TNF-a inhibitors can also be medicated with the cytokine modulators Rituxan and Xeljanz. Thus, the extensive range of available therapies is addressing the need for efficacious therapies for a broad spectrum of RA patients.

Large and Diverse Pipeline

The liver cancer pipeline contains 238 products in active development, approximately 47% of which are first-in-class. The percentage of the pipeline devoted to innovative products is considerably larger than both the industry and oncology average, which is a promising sign for novel therapeutics reaching the liver cancer market.


The contrast between the market and pipeline is vast. Analysis showed that the market contains 70 products, the majority of which are generic formulations of chemotherapies that are not frequently used in treatment, particularly in advanced-stage patients. Nexavar (sorafenib) is the dominant therapeutic on the market, and is also the only targeted therapy that is in regular use for advanced-stage liver cancer patients. However, pipeline analysis revealed that targeted therapies aimed at the underlying oncogenic signaling pathways are under much greater focus in the pipeline than in the market. The success of targeted therapies across the oncology market as a whole implies that the diversity and innovation in the pipeline is a promising sign, with products currently in development having the potential to transform and improve the relatively open liver cancer market.
Alignment of First-in-Class Molecular Targets with Disease Causation

The liver cancer pipeline is showing signs of adapting to the increasing understanding of aberrant signaling pathways and causes of liver cancer. A large portion of pipeline products target components of known dysfunctional signaling pathways, such as Wnt/ß–catenin signaling, which is commonly mutated in liver cancer tumor samples. By aligning the treatment with specific disease-causing features, the damaging off-target cytotoxic effects of treatment can be reduced, resulting in safer and more efficacious therapies.

Large and Innovative Pipeline
The active pain pipeline is populated by 796 products across all stages of development, which exhibit a highly diverse range of molecular targets. GBI Research’s analyses identified 122 first-in-class programs in active development, constituting 13.6% of the pipeline and acting on 65 first-in-class molecular targets, indicating a high degree of innovation. This is in stark contrast to the pain therapeutics market, which has been largely characterized by only incremental product innovation over the last decade, as most market segments continue to be dominated by long-established active pharmaceutical ingredients and the concomitant mechanisms of action. Moderate-to-severe pain continues to be dominated by opioids that are increasingly being reformulated to offer abuse-resistance, while mild pain is effectively treated with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s (NSAID). However, significant unmet needs remain, as chronic pain and some neuropathic pain subtypes do not respond well to existing therapies, which are not adequate to treat associated hypersensitization and do not align to the underlying molecular pathophysiological profile.


Despite being mostly distributed in the early stages of development, first-in-class innovation is particularly concentrated on novel molecular targets that are aligned to the central sensitization associated with neuropathic pain, which is arguably the most debilitating and difficult-to-treat type of chronic pain. This gives them the potential to transform the future market by expanding the range of drug classes.

Highly Diversified Range of Innovative Programs in Early Pipeline and in Granted Patents
Pain is a complex and multifaceted disorder with a complex interplay between different pathological processes, and different pain subtypes exhibit distinct underlying etiologies and pathophysiologies. While technological advances and extensive research efforts have furthered the understanding of these complex underpinnings, gaps remain. However, these insights have translated into the expanding pool of novel therapeutic targets, as reflected by the highly innovative pipeline. GBI Research’s proprietary analysis shows that early-stage, first-in-class programs exhibit a higher level of diversity with respect to novel therapeutic targets. The significant diversity in terms of targets is a reflection of the complex underpinnings of distinct pain subtypes. Although the pipeline continues to feature established therapies, the range of mechanisms of action employed by novel compounds is extremely diverse, with the vast majority residing in the Preclinical stage. This innovation and diversity is maintained throughout the pipeline from early- to late-stage development, although the degree of innovation diminishes from Phase II. Melanoma is a highly heterogeneous disease comprising Cutaneous Melanoma (CM), Ocular Melanoma (OM), Mucosal Melanoma (MM), melanoma of the internal organs, and, according to some classifications, melanoma of the soft parts (non-bony and non-cartilaginous tissues) of the body. CM is by far the most common form of melanoma, accounting for approximately 90-95% of all melanomas.


Historically, melanoma has been considered as a very challenging disease to treat with pharmacotherapy. However, in recent years, understanding of the pathophysiology and heterogeneity of melanoma, and particularly CM, has developed considerably. This has led to the approval of several new drug agents indicated for CM since 2011, namely Sylatron (peginterferon alfa-2b), Yervoy (ipilimumab), Opdivo, (nivolumab), Keytruda (pembrolizumab), Zelboraf (vemurafenib), Tafinlar (dabrafenib) and Mekinist (trametinib). These drugs have dramatically improved the treatment options for CM patients, leading to unprecedented market growth.

Rapid market growth is also anticipated over the forecast period due to the expanding melanoma treatment population and the continued uptake of recently approved drugs. The melanoma pipeline is currently strong, with several promising molecules in development including, Polynoma's seviprotimut-L, Amgen's talimogene laherparepvec (T-VEC) and Roche and Genentech's cobimetinib in combination with Zelboraf, which are in development for CM, as well as AstraZeneca's selumetinib which is in development for OM. Consequently, the melanoma therapeutics market is projected to grow from $1.3 billion in 2013 to $3.6 billion in 2020, at a CAGR of 15.4%.

Treatment and prognosis in AML is strongly influenced by a patient's age, and their cytogenetic profile. In the majority of cases these two prognostic influences are linked, with a higher frequency of unfavorable cytogenetic abnormalities observed in the elderly. Survival in this cohort of elderly patients is very poor, with a five year overall survival of 3-8% (Luger, 2010). Despite a relatively advanced understanding of genetic abnormalities associated with AML, the introduction of targeted therapies is lagging in this indication in comparison to other cancers such as breast and lung cancer, with no approved targeted therapies. Such slow development may be a reflection of AMLs status as an orphan indication.


Intensive treatment in eligible patients (younger patients, and approximately 50% of diagnosed elderly patients) is typically the combination of the two chemotherapeutic agents cytarabine and daunorubicin, both of which were approved in the 1960s. In patients ineligible for intensive first-line chemotherapy, options are very poor, with the more recently approved Vidaza and Dacogen as the treatment options, which both offer unsatisfactory survival. Across all newly diagnosed patients that obtain complete remission, a stem cell transplant offers the highest chance of long-term survival. However, this procedure is risky, with a higher rate of treatment related mortality in the absence of better techniques to reduce the risk of graft-versus-host disease.

The majority of patients experience disease relapse, which is almost always fatal. Treatment options in these patients typically involve the off-label use of chemotherapeutic agents, whether in combination or as monotherapies.

Large Degree of Innovation in NSCLC Pipeline
The NSCLC pipeline currently has 389 products in active development across all stages, but a stark contrast between the mechanisms of action employed in the current market and the pipeline is evident. Where the market comprises primarily ineffective chemotherapies that target tubulin or DNA replication, the pipeline shows an incredibly diverse range of therapies targeting multiple signaling pathways and molecules integral to cancer development. This diversity is partially due to the presence of 122 first-in-class products, which accounts for 38% of the overall pipeline therapies that disclosed their target. In an industry, market and development landscape that favors first-in-class over non-first-in-class development in many ways, such as through faster approval or greater revenue, this finding has strategic implications for a wide array of market participants, both large and small. Despite a high attrition rate in NSCLC, first-in-class therapies that reach the market have the potential to transform and improve the NSCLC treatment landscape.


Alignment of First-in-Class Molecular Target with Disease Causation
The method of characterizing NSCLC tumors is currently shifting from the traditional histology-based characterization to a more specific molecule-based method of characterization. This has resulted in the identification of key oncogenic mutations in NSCLC and has coincided with the rise of targeted pipeline therapies, which are designed to target proteins in signaling pathways that are frequently mutated, amplified or overexpressed in NSCLC. Aligning the molecular target with disease-causing signaling pathways and frequently mutated pathways therapies can benefit from reduced systemic cytotoxic effects while still inhibiting tumor-promoting signaling. Therefore, targeted therapies often display superior safety and efficacy to chemotherapies.

In 2013, the value of the MDD therapeutics market in major developed countries amounted to an estimated $8.7 billion. The market is forecast to decline at a negative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 1.1% between 2013 and 2020 to reach $8.1 billion. The decline is due to key patent expiries of blockbuster drugs such as Lexapro, Cymbalta, Abilify, and Seroquel XR during the forecast period. The expected launch of few promising pipeline molecules such as brexpiprazole, cariprazine, ALKS-5461, GLYX-13 is likely to offset the key patent expiries. Recently launched Brintellix which has a novel multimodal mechanism of action and is the only drug which can provide improvements in cognitive function is expected to lead the market by the end of forecasting period.
